COVER

THE COOK HOME, the first place winner in the residential category of Masonry Magazine's 1995 Excellence in Masonry Awards, is located in Colorado. Despite the poor weather conditions, Mountain States Masonry, of Aspen, Colorado, managed to complete this home in just over a year, and achieve the precise look the owners were looking for. The exterior design, Flagstone and Buff Strip Stone were used to incorporate Aspen landscape to the home's design. A large hot tub, set in Buff Flagstone, overlooks the ski runs of Snowmass. The home is 7200 square feet, including the exterior of 12,000 square feet of Loveland Buff Strip Stone, all "pillow-faced" and hand cut. Round windows were keystoned with Buff Strip Stone in a circular design to produce a unique framed design. Much of the detailing was done on-the-job extemporaneously by Mountain States Masonry. The brick used in the living room fireplace were set in a matched herringbone pattern which offsets the buff strip stone. The home incorporated arches and circles throughout, each executed, adding a soft yet formal feel to the home's ambience. The porte cochere is built entirely of 24" x 30" blocks of stone hand-carved. This grand entry leads to the doorway which was also carefully constructed in a framed arch design. The architect is Mark Ward of Mark Ward & Associates of Boulder, Colorado, and the principal masonry supplier is Loukonen Brothers Stone of Lyons, Colorado.
